Camera Gear and Photography Tips for GC#
Gran Canaria’s varied landscapes mean you’ll want to pack accordingly. A versatile lens, such as a 24-70mm, is ideal for both landscape and portrait shots. If you’re focusing on the beaches, a polarizing filter can enhance the colors of the sea and sky. Remember to carry extra batteries and memory cards, as you might find yourself shooting more than you planned.

When it comes to attire, lightweight and breathable clothing is essential, especially if you’re exploring rugged terrains. The weather can change quickly, so consider layering. Comfortable shoes are a must, particularly if you plan to hike to different photo spots.
